is it safe to eat fries left out overnight?
If you’re wondering if it’s safe to eat fries left out overnight, the answer is a resounding no. Fries, like all other cooked foods, are susceptible to bacterial growth when left out at room temperature. Bacteria thrive in warm, moist environments, and fries provide the perfect breeding ground. Within a few hours, harmful bacteria like Staphylococcus aureus and E. coli can multiply to dangerous levels, potentially causing food poisoning. Symptoms of food poisoning can range from mild discomfort to severe illness, including n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and abdominal pain. In some cases, food poisoning can even be life-threatening. To avoid the risk of food poisoning, always refrigerate or freeze cooked fries within two hours of cooking. If you’re unsure how long fries have been left out, it’s best to err on the side of caution and throw them away.
do leftover french fries need to be refrigerated?
Leftover french fries can be stored in the refrigerator for later consumption, but there are some important steps to follow to ensure they remain safe and tasty. First, allow the fries to cool completely before storing them. This will help prevent the growth of bacteria and keep the fries crispy. Once cool, place the fries in an airtight container or resealable plastic bag. Be sure to remove as much air as possible from the container or bag before sealing it. This will help prevent the fries from becoming soggy. The fries can then be stored in the refrigerator for up to three days. When you’re ready to eat them, reheat them in a preheated oven at 350 degrees Fahrenheit for about 10 minutes, or until they are heated through. You can also reheat them in a toaster oven or air fryer.

is it safe to eat cooked potatoes left out overnight?
Cooked potatoes, a versatile culinary delight, often grace our tables as a delectable side dish or a hearty main course. However, the question arises: Is it safe to consume cooked potatoes that have been left out overnight? The answer hinges on several crucial factors. If the cooked potatoes were left out at room temperature for an extended period, they may harbor harmful bacteria, rendering them unsafe for consumption. Bacteria thrive in warm environments, and leaving cooked potatoes at room temperature creates an ideal breeding ground for these microorganisms. These bacteria can produce toxins that can cause foodborne illnesses, leading to unpleasant symptoms such as n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ea.
To ensure the safety of cooked potatoes, proper storage is paramount. Once cooked, potatoes should be promptly refrigerated within two hours to minimize the risk of bacterial growth. Refrigeration slows down the growth and multiplication of bacteria, helping to preserve the quality and safety of the potatoes. If you intend to store cooked potatoes for an extended period, freezing is a viable option. Frozen potatoes can be safely stored for several months without compromising their quality or safety.
When reheating cooked potatoes, it is essential to ensure that they are thoroughly heated throughout. This eliminates any potential bacteria that may have survived the refrigeration or freezing process. Reheating cooked potatoes to an internal temperature of 165 degrees Fahrenheit (74 degrees Celsius) effectively kills bacteria and ensures their safety for consumption.
In conclusion, the safety of cooked potatoes left out overnight depends on the storage conditions and handling practices. Prompt refrigeration or freezing, along with proper reheating techniques, are crucial in preventing bacterial growth and ensuring the safe consumption of cooked potatoes.

what food can be left out at room temperature?
Certain foods can be safely left out at room temperature for varying periods of time. Hard cheeses like Parmesan and cheddar, as well as processed cheeses like American and mozzarella, can last for several days. Butter and margarine are also shelf-stable for a few days. Fruits and vegetables with thick skins, such as apples, oranges, and bananas, can also be left out for a few days. Certain condiments like ketchup, mustard, and mayonnaise can be left out for a few weeks. Dried foods like pasta, rice, and beans can be stored at room temperature indefinitely. However, perishable foods like meat, poultry, fish, eggs, and dairy products should never be left out at room temperature for more than two hours. These foods should be refrigerated or frozen to prevent the growth of harmful bacteria.

how quickly does food poisoning kick in?
Food poisoning can strike quickly or may take several days to manifest. The time it takes for symptoms to appear depends on the type of bacteria or virus causing the illness, as well as the amount of contaminated food consumed. Some bacteria, such as Staphylococcus aureus, can cause symptoms within hours, while others, such as Salmonella or E. coli, can take several days or even weeks to cause illness. Some common symptoms of food poisoning include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and abdominal pain. In severe cases, food poisoning can lead to dehydration, electrolyte imbalance, and even death. It is important to seek medical attention immediately if you experience any symptoms of food poisoning, especially if you have a weakened immune system or are pregnant. Food poisoning can be prevented by following proper food safety practices, such as thoroughly washing hands and food, cooking food to the proper temperature, and avoiding cross-contamination of foods.
